Janna is currently the #2196 girl name in the United States — 84 babies received it in 2025. A decade ago it stood at #2209, so the name has been rising over the past ten years. Roughly one in every 21,429 girls born in 2025 was named Janna.
The 113-year story
Janna first appears in the Social Security records in 1912, when 6 girls received the name. Its peak came in 1979, when 428 girls were named Janna — good for #469 that year. Today's parents encounter it as a name from their grandparents’ generation, which is precisely the vintage window from which names get revived. Where Janna is most common
Geography matters for names, and Janna is no exception. In 2025 the states with the most Jannas were TX (10), CA (9), NC (7), NY (7), FL (6). Raw counts naturally favor populous states, but the spread still hints at where the name is part of the local naming culture.

Rank history (last 25 years)
| Year | Babies named Janna | Rank |
|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 84 | #2194 |
| 2024 | 90 | #2118 |
| 2023 | 70 | #2517 |
| 2022 | 77 | #2388 |
| 2021 | 69 | #2533 |
| 2020 | 77 | #2302 |
| 2019 | 76 | #2355 |
| 2018 | 79 | #2302 |
| 2017 | 90 | #2129 |
| 2016 | 88 | #2188 |
| 2015 | 85 | #2209 |
| 2014 | 69 | #2560 |
| 2013 | 101 | #1953 |
| 2012 | 82 | #2286 |
| 2011 | 67 | #2638 |
| 2010 | 99 | #2010 |
| 2009 | 101 | #2029 |
| 2008 | 94 | #2137 |
| 2007 | 115 | #1838 |
| 2006 | 122 | #1709 |
| 2005 | 131 | #1553 |
| 2004 | 129 | #1542 |
| 2003 | 142 | #1395 |
| 2002 | 143 | #1351 |
| 2001 | 147 | #1304 |
